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
The Principles of Metal Polishing - Most frequently, the polishing of metal is required for aesthetic reasons or for clean-room applications. It's one of the more prominent techniques because of its utility in intensifying the overall attractiveness of the item, for instance, cookware, motor vehicle parts or motorbike parts. Similarly, a large number of clean-rooms want a lustrous finish so as to minimize the penetrability of the metal surfaces that may result in dirt to collect and contaminate. A really good illustration of this practice could be in a vacuum chamber. You'll find a variety of means to polish metals, and we can look at the various processes involved. Metal can be finished by hand, using purpose made buffing machines, electromechanically or employing chemicals. A finishing compound or paste is frequently employed, that could contain aluminum oxide, tripoli, limestone, chalk, chromium oxide, dolomite, or iron oxide. Buffing stainless steel, due to its low th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its rather high viscosity is amongst the time intensive. In contrast, goods crafted from non-ferrous metal will be more receptive to polishing, because these need the least number of processes.
When a high processing quality is not really essential, swifter pad speeds can be utilized. A lower pad speed is required whenever a good quality mirror finish is mandatory. Finishing buffs daubed with paste are noticeably affected by specific pressure on the surface of the pad. The level of the pressure on the surface can be increased to a chosen level, having said that, surpassing the most effective degree of load not simply minimizes the quality of the procedure, but also decreases the level of efficiency, can lead to wear on the component, and there is also an obvious heating of the material being worked on, generated by friction. When you are working on thin objects, it is increased temperature (and a relating bendability of the metal) that can cause components to twist, distort, or bend. In general, it requires a skilled polisher to consider every one of these elements to both not cause harm to the metal part and to deliver the results competently. To radically boost the standard of the resulting finish, the polishing procedure must be done with considerably less vigour and not so much pressure so as to after a while produce a surface that doesn't have any scores or marks caused by the polishing process, subsequently ending up with a lovely mirror finish.
